#include "e.h"
typedef struct _Instance Instance;
struct _Instance
{
E_Gadcon_Client *gcc;
Evas_Object *obj;
Ecore_Exe *wifiget_exe;
Ecore_Event_Handler *wifiget_data_handler;
Ecore_Event_Handler *wifiget_del_handler;
int strength;
};
/* gadcon requirements */
static E_Gadcon_Client *_gc_init(E_Gadcon *gc, const char *name, const char *id, const char *style);
static void _gc_shutdown(E_Gadcon_Client *gcc);
static void _gc_orient(E_Gadcon_Client *gcc, E_Gadcon_Orient orient);
static char *_gc_label(E_Gadcon_Client_Class *client_class);
static Evas_Object *_gc_icon(E_Gadcon_Client_Class *client_class, Evas *evas);
static const char *_gc_id_new(E_Gadcon_Client_Class *client_class);
/* and actually define the gadcon class that this module provides (just 1) */
static const E_Gadcon_Client_Class _gadcon_class =
{
GADCON_CLIENT_CLASS_VERSION,
"illume-wifi",
{
_gc_init, _gc_shutdown, _gc_orient, _gc_label, _gc_icon, _gc_id_new, NULL,
e_gadcon_site_is_not_toolbar
},
E_GADCON_CLIENT_STYLE_PLAIN
};
static E_Module *mod = NULL;
static void _wifiget_spawn(Instance *inst);
static void _wifiget_kill(Instance *inst);
static Eina_Bool _wifiget_cb_exe_data(void *data, int type, void *event);
static Eina_Bool _wifiget_cb_exe_del(void *data, int type, void *event);
/* called from the module core */
void
_e_mod_gad_wifi_init(E_Module *m)
{
mod = m;
e_gadcon_provider_register(&_gadcon_class);
}
void
_e_mod_gad_wifi_shutdown(void)
{
e_gadcon_provider_unregister(&_gadcon_class);
mod = NULL;
}
/* internal calls */
static Evas_Object *
_theme_obj_new(Evas *e, const char *custom_dir, const char *group)
{
Evas_Object *o;
o = edje_object_add(e);
if (!e_theme_edje_object_set(o, "base/theme/modules/illume", group))
{
if (custom_dir)
{
char buf[PATH_MAX];
snprintf(buf, sizeof(buf), "%s/illume.edj", custom_dir);
if (edje_object_file_set(o, buf, group))
{
printf("OK FALLBACK %s\n", buf);
}
}
}
return o;
}
static E_Gadcon_Client *
_gc_init(E_Gadcon *gc, const char *name, const char *id, const char *style)
{
Evas_Object *o;
E_Gadcon_Client *gcc;
Instance *inst;
inst = E_NEW(Instance, 1);
o = _theme_obj_new(gc->evas, e_module_dir_get(mod),
"e/modules/illume/gadget/wifi");
evas_object_show(o);
gcc = e_gadcon_client_new(gc, name, id, style, o);
gcc->data = inst;
inst->gcc = gcc;
inst->obj = o;
e_gadcon_client_util_menu_attach(gcc);
inst->strength = -1;
_wifiget_spawn(inst);
return gcc;
}
static void
_gc_shutdown(E_Gadcon_Client *gcc)
{
Instance *inst;
inst = gcc->data;
_wifiget_kill(inst);
evas_object_del(inst->obj);
free(inst);
}
static void
_gc_orient(E_Gadcon_Client *gcc, E_Gadcon_Orient orient __UNUSED__)
{
Instance *inst;
Evas_Coord mw, mh, mxw, mxh;
inst = gcc->data;
mw = 0, mh = 0;
edje_object_size_min_get(inst->obj, &mw, &mh);
edje_object_size_max_get(inst->obj, &mxw, &mxh);
if ((mw < 1) || (mh < 1))
edje_object_size_min_calc(inst->obj, &mw, &mh);
if (mw < 4) mw = 4;
if (mh < 4) mh = 4;
if ((mxw > 0) && (mxh > 0))
e_gadcon_client_aspect_set(gcc, mxw, mxh);
e_gadcon_client_min_size_set(gcc, mw, mh);
}
static char *
_gc_label(E_Gadcon_Client_Class *client_class __UNUSED__)
{
return "Wifi (Illume)";
}
static Evas_Object *
_gc_icon(E_Gadcon_Client_Class *client_class __UNUSED__, Evas *evas __UNUSED__)
{
/* FIXME: need icon
Evas_Object *o;
char buf[PATH_MAX];
o = edje_object_add(evas);
snprintf(buf, sizeof(buf), "%s/e-module-clock.edj",
e_module_dir_get(clock_module));
edje_object_file_set(o, buf, "icon");
return o;
*/
return NULL;
}
static const char *
_gc_id_new(E_Gadcon_Client_Class *client_class __UNUSED__)
{
return _gadcon_class.name;
}
static void
_wifiget_spawn(Instance *inst)
{
char buf[PATH_MAX];
if (inst->wifiget_exe) return;
snprintf(buf, sizeof(buf), "%s/%s/wifiget %i",
e_module_dir_get(mod), MODULE_ARCH, 8);
inst->wifiget_exe = ecore_exe_pipe_run(buf,
ECORE_EXE_PIPE_READ |
ECORE_EXE_PIPE_READ_LINE_BUFFERED |
ECORE_EXE_NOT_LEADER,
inst);
inst->wifiget_data_handler =
ecore_event_handler_add(ECORE_EXE_EVENT_DATA, _wifiget_cb_exe_data, inst);
inst->wifiget_del_handler =
ecore_event_handler_add(ECORE_EXE_EVENT_DEL, _wifiget_cb_exe_del, inst);
}
static void
_wifiget_kill(Instance *inst)
{
if (!inst->wifiget_exe) return;
ecore_exe_terminate(inst->wifiget_exe);
ecore_exe_free(inst->wifiget_exe);
inst->wifiget_exe = NULL;
ecore_event_handler_del(inst->wifiget_data_handler);
inst->wifiget_data_handler = NULL;
ecore_event_handler_del(inst->wifiget_del_handler);
inst->wifiget_del_handler = NULL;
}
static Eina_Bool
_wifiget_cb_exe_data(void *data, int type __UNUSED__, void *event)
{
Ecore_Exe_Event_Data *ev;
Instance *inst;
int pstrength;
inst = data;
ev = event;
if (ev->exe != inst->wifiget_exe) return ECORE_CALLBACK_PASS_ON;
pstrength = inst->strength;
if ((ev->lines) && (ev->lines[0].line))
{
int i;
for (i = 0; ev->lines[i].line; i++)
{
if (!strcmp(ev->lines[i].line, "ERROR"))
inst->strength = -999;
else
inst->strength = atoi(ev->lines[i].line);
}
}
if (inst->strength != pstrength)
{
Edje_Message_Float msg;
double level;
level = (double)inst->strength / 100.0;
if (level < 0.0) level = 0.0;
else if (level > 1.0) level = 1.0;
msg.val = level;
edje_object_message_send(inst->obj, EDJE_MESSAGE_FLOAT, 1, &msg);
}
return ECORE_CALLBACK_DONE;
}
static Eina_Bool
_wifiget_cb_exe_del(void *data, int type __UNUSED__, void *event)
{
Ecore_Exe_Event_Del *ev;
Instance *inst;
inst = data;
ev = event;
if (ev->exe != inst->wifiget_exe) return ECORE_CALLBACK_PASS_ON;
inst->wifiget_exe = NULL;
return ECORE_CALLBACK_PASS_ON;
}
